The Frederick Rescue Mission (FRM) has positions open in their Summer Enrichment Camp (SEC) 2025 for a Director, Assistant Director, and Camp Counselors. 

The Elementary Summer Enrichment Camp (SEC) is a Christ-centered, five-week day camp for children in 1st – 5th grades who are at risk for making grade level, lower income, or experiencing homelessness.  The Middle School SEC is one week and runs from June 23rd-June 27th.SEC runs from June 30th – July 31st, 2025, Monday – Thursday 8:30 a.m. - 3:30 p.m.  There are two camp locations: one in Frederick and another in Thurmont.  Ten hours of training for these positions occur the week before camp begins.
